HMRC have just named 202 employers who breached NMW rules. You don’t want to be on the next list. So, if you pay NMW rates check that you don’t make inappropriate deductions for : Food/meals Parking permits and/or travel costs Cost of, or lost, work equipment and/or Personal Protective Equipment Stock or till shortages Training
